In most common implementation models, the content filter has two components: 4. rating and filtering. Content filtering is a technique that restricts access to certain types of online content that are considered inappropriate or harmful.

The rating component of a content filter is responsible for assigning a rating to each piece of content that is being filtered. The rating typically indicates the level of maturity or appropriateness of the content. This rating is then used by the filtering component of the content filter to decide whether or not to allow access to the content. The filtering component of the content filter is responsible for examining each piece of content and determining whether or not it meets certain criteria.

This criteria may include the rating assigned to the content, the type of content, and other factors. If the content meets the criteria, it is allowed through the content filter. If it does not meet the criteria, it is blocked. It is important to note that the two components of the content filter, rating and filtering, work together to ensure that only appropriate content is allowed through the filter. Without the rating component, it would be difficult for the filtering component to accurately determine whether or not a piece of content is appropriate. Without the filtering component, the rating component would be useless, as inappropriate content could still be accessed.

The appropriate command to point out to the MySQL server that a change has occurred is FLUSH PRIVILEGES.

FLUSH PRIVILEGES is a command used to reload the privileges from the grant tables in the MySQL database.

It is often used after making changes to the privilege tables such as adding, modifying or deleting user accounts or privileges.

The command can be executed in the MySQL command prompt by typing "FLUSH PRIVILEGES;" and pressing enter.

Once the command is executed, the server will reload the grant tables and apply the changes made to the privileges.

It is important to note that changes made to the grant tables will not take effect until the privileges have been reloaded using the FLUSH PRIVILEGES command.

The operating system that requires a separate, licensed copy when added as a virtual machine is a. Microsoft Windows. This is because Windows is a proprietary operating system, and its license agreement requires a separate license for each instance or installation.

This means that if you want to run Windows as a virtual machine, you need to have a valid license for each virtual machine instance. On the other hand, open-source operating systems such as OpenBSD, Ubuntu Linux, and FreeDOS are typically licensed under free and open-source licenses that allow for unlimited copies and installations. This means that you can run these operating systems as virtual machines without needing a separate license for each instance. It is important to note, however, that even though some open-source operating systems do not require a separate license, you should still be aware of the terms and conditions of their respective license agreements. Some open-source licenses may require you to disclose any modifications you make to the software or limit your ability to distribute it, so it is important to read and understand the license agreement before using the software.

A standard offset screwdriver is used when there is not enough room for a regular screwdriver.

A standard offset screwdriver is a type of screwdriver with a bend in the shank that allows the tip to be offset from the handle. The offset design provides a greater degree of accessibility to screws that are located in tight spaces or close to other objects where a regular screwdriver would not fit.

The offset screwdriver is particularly useful in situations where there is not enough room for a regular screwdriver, such as in tight corners or when a screw is located next to a wall or other obstruction. The offset design allows the user to approach the screw at a different angle, making it easier to access and turn.

In the CPT manual, you can find a complete listing of all add-on codes in Appendix D.

This section contains a comprehensive list of all add-on codes, which are designated by the "+" symbol. Add-on codes are used to indicate additional services or procedures performed during a patient encounter, and they must always be reported in conjunction with a primary code. It's important to note that add-on codes cannot be reported alone and do not have a standalone value. When using add-on codes, it's crucial to follow the specific guidelines outlined in the CPT manual to ensure accurate coding and appropriate reimbursement.

One reason why ceramic materials are generally harder yet more brittle than metals is related to the nature of their bonding. Ceramic materials often have a predominantly ionic or covalent bonding, which leads to strong primary bonds between atoms. These primary bonds are responsible for the hardness of ceramics.

However, the strong primary bonds in ceramics also make them inherently brittle. When subjected to stress, the primary bonds tend to break rather than undergo plastic deformation, causing the material to fracture. In contrast, metals have a more metallic bonding, which allows for the movement of atoms or ions in response to stress, leading to plastic deformation and increased toughness.
